5.41% of Pati Regency's Population Will Have a Higher Education by the End of 2024

Data from the Directorate General of Population and Civil Registration (Dukcapil) shows that the population of Pati Regency, Central Java, reached 1.39 million in 2024.
However, only 5.41% of the population had received higher education by the end of 2024.
The proportion of the population with D1 and D2 education was 0.27%, while D3 was 1.02%. Furthermore, the population with a Bachelor's degree (S1) reached 3.93%, Master's degree (S2) 0.19%, and Doctoral degree (S3) 0.005%.
Furthermore, the proportion of the population with a high school (SMA) diploma was 18.82%. Junior high school (SMP) and elementary school (SD) graduates were 18.02% and 26.77%, respectively.
Meanwhile, 12.12% of the population of Pati Regency had not completed elementary school. The number of people who have not attended/completed any schooling was 18.86%.
The following is a detailed breakdown of the population of Pati Regency, Central Java, by education level at the end of 2024:
1. Doctoral Degree (S3): 76 people (0.005%)
2. Master's Degree (S2): 2,589 people (0.19%)
3. Bachelor's Degree (S1): 54,520 people (3.93%)
4. Diploma 3 (D3): 14,140 people (1.02%)
5. Diploma 1 and 2 (D1 and D2): 3,714 people (0.27%)
6. High School (SMA): 260,800 people (18.82%)
7. Junior High School (SMP): 249,790 people (18.02%)
8. Completed Elementary School (SD): 370,960 people (26.77%)
9. Did Not Complete Elementary School: 167,920 people (12.12%)
10. No Schooling/Never Attended School: 261,390 people (18.86%)
